WebApr 6, 2024 · For a high-capacity all-in-one washer dryer, the LG WM3998HBA is your best bet. This model has a 4.5-cubic-foot drum that's nearly double the size of other popular combo units (such as the GE GFQ14ESSNWW, our best overall pick, which only has 2.4 cubic feet of space). It costs between $1.56 to $7.61 per … is best western owned by marriottWebFeb 11, 2024 · Small and standard freeze dryers use a standard 110 volt outlet. At peak, the freeze dryer draws about 16 amps, but on the average about 9 to 11 amps (990-1210 watts) of power per hour. A dedicated 20 amp circuit is recommended. Your freeze dryer will cost an estimated $1.25-$2.80 a day, depending on power costs in your area.
